United States Ninth Circuit
Sali v. Corona Regional Medical Center, 15-56460
Reversing a district court denial of class certification in a putative class action by Registered Nurses against a medical center alleging employment claims because, in determining the certification of a class, the court could not decline to consider evidence simply because it was inadmissible at trial and while they agreed that a party was not an adequate class representative, that wasn't a valid basis to deny certification. They also held that the court abused its discretion in finding a law firm was not adequate class counsel, a decision that was premature, and the court erred in denying certification of claims under the predominance requirement.
